Service by design:  Although a web site can have many benefits they are not always immediate. Some benefits depend on the web site's listing by search engines like Yahoo, Lycos or MSN. Without a search engine, listing your services might only be realized by a handful of people. Search engine submittal is a crucial step in making your services available through the web, but it is by no means the only step. Content and good design -both technical & aesthetic- are the ultimate keys to your sites success. Unless your site is optimized for the search engines it will be just another listing in a sea of links. Coding descriptors called meta-tag keywords, descriptive naming of web pages, robot text documents that tell search engines robots what to look at, and a site's content all play key roles in the searchabillity and ranking of a site.

The design process for a web site can be the most complicated aspect of building it. There are many ways in which a site can be designed and many different scripting and programming languages to implement the inner workings of the site. Deciding which methodologies will work best for you depends on your reasons for needing a site.
